The U.S. sputtering targets market faces a confluence of structural challenges that threaten long-term profitability and market stability. Price volatility remains a dominant concern, driven by fluctuating raw material costs, geopolitical tensions affecting supply sources, and cyclical demand patterns across end-use sectors such as electronics, aerospace, and renewable energy. These fluctuations complicate pricing strategies and erode margins, especially for suppliers with limited hedging capabilities or diversified sourcing. Supply chain fragmentation further exacerbates vulnerabilities, as regional disparities in raw material availability, geopolitical restrictions, and logistical bottlenecks hinder seamless procurement and inventory management. This fragmentation results in increased lead times and elevated costs, which can dampen competitiveness and deter new entrants. Regulatory shifts, including stricter environmental standards and export controls, impose additional compliance burdens, elevating operational costs and constraining innovation pathways. Procurement inefficiencies, often stemming from lack of integrated digital systems and fragmented supplier networks, lead to suboptimal inventory levels and increased procurement costs, undermining profitability at both regional and segment levels. Competitive intensity is intensifying, with a growing number of specialized manufacturers and emerging low-cost producers, pressuring pricing and margins. Technology disruption, particularly advancements in additive manufacturing and alternative deposition techniques, threaten traditional sputtering processes, necessitating continuous innovation investments. Innovation bottlenecks, characterized by lengthy R&D cycles and high capital expenditure, limit rapid product development and adaptation to evolving customer needs. Entry barriers, including high capital requirements, technological complexity, and entrenched supplier relationships, restrict new competitors but also concentrate market power among established players. Collectively, these challenges threaten long-term profitability, especially in segments reliant on high-value, technologically complex targets, and in regions where supply chain resilience remains weak, demanding strategic agility and robust risk management frameworks.

Sputtering targets are materials used in the process of physical vapor deposition, where a target material is bombarded by energetic particles to eject atoms onto a substrate.
Sputtering targets are used in applications such as semiconductor manufacturing, flat panel display production, and solar cell production.
